Roofing SEO Services

Trusted By 47+ Roofers

Dominate Local Search with Our Roofing SEO Company

Transform your roofing business with targeted SEO strategies to generate consistent leads and grow your customer base. At Roofing Web Design Agency, we specialize in helping roofing companies rank higher on search engines, attract more local customers, and dominate their service areas. Whether you’re just starting or looking to scale, our proven approach ensures your website gets the visibility it deserves, so you can focus on what you do best—delivering top-quality roofing services.

Roofing SEO Services

Why Choose Us for Your Roofing SEO?

Industry Expertise

We understand the unique challenges roofers face and know how to craft SEO strategies that attract high-quality, local leads. By targeting low-competition, high-conversion keywords specific to your roofing services and location, we ensure your website ranks where potential customers are searching. Our tailored SEO approach shows measurable results in just a few weeks, helping your roofing business gain visibility, increase website traffic, and generate consistent leads quickly. 

Transparent Process

Our SEO process is straightforward and completely transparent—no confusing jargon or hidden strategies. From keyword research to monthly performance reports, you’ll always know what we’re doing, why we’re doing it, and how it’s helping your roofing business grow. We keep you in the loop every step of the way, so you can confidently track your return on investment and see the results of our efforts.

Monthly Reports

Every month, you’ll receive a detailed SEO report that keeps you informed about your campaign’s progress. This report includes updated keyword rankings, website traffic data, and a summary of the work completed over the month, such as content updates, on-page optimizations, and link-building efforts. Additionally, we provide an action plan for the upcoming month, outlining the next steps to continue improving your rankings and driving more leads. Our transparent reporting ensures you stay in the loop and see the measurable impact of our SEO strategies on your roofing business.

Our Roofing SEO Process

Website Audit & Analysis

Our process begins with a thorough website audit to identify both the strengths and weaknesses of your current online presence. We evaluate your website’s structure, content, and overall SEO performance, reviewing everything from page load speeds to mobile responsiveness. We also analyze your keyword rankings to see where you stand compared to competitors. Our team inspects each page for on-page SEO factors like title tags, meta descriptions, and internal linking. We also review your Google Analytics and Search Console data to identify potential issues, track user behavior, and uncover opportunities for improvement. This in-depth analysis helps us create a tailored strategy to optimize your site and drive better results.

On-Page Optimization

Once the website audit is complete, we focus on refining the elements that directly impact your site’s performance. This includes fixing any technical issues like 301 redirects, broken links, and missing meta descriptions. We ensure that all the images have optimized alt tags to improve accessibility and SEO. Our team also works on enhancing website speed, reducing load times, and ensuring your site is mobile-friendly for a seamless user experience. Every aspect of on-page optimization is aimed at making your website more efficient, user-friendly, and ready for higher search engine visibility.

Content Creation & Optimization

We focus on creating new pages that target local keywords specific to your roofing services, such as “roof repair in [city]” or “roof replacement services.” This includes adding new service pages, blog posts, or location-specific content to help you rank for the search terms that matter most to your business. We also optimize existing pages by refining content, incorporating high-converting keywords, and ensuring the copy is relevant to what potential customers are searching for.

What to Expect From Our Roofing SEO Services

More Leads

Our targeted SEO strategies will help your roofing business attract more local, high-quality leads. By optimizing your site for the right keywords, we increase your visibility, driving more inquiries, calls, and form submissions to grow your customer base.

Increased Revenue

Our SEO strategy drives qualified traffic to your site, increasing conversions and revenue. By targeting high-converting, low-competition keywords, we attract customers who are ready to book roofing services, boosting your profits.

Monthly Reports

We provide a detailed monthly report that includes your keyword rankings, website traffic, and the work we’ve completed to improve the SEO of your roofing business. We’ll also outline our plan for the upcoming month, ensuring you’re always informed about the next steps we’ll be taking.

Frequently Asked Questions

How much does your roofing SEO service cost?

Our roofing SEO services start at $399 per month. However, there is no one-size-fits-all approach. Depending on your business goals and needs, the cost may range from $400 to $3000 per month. We can discuss the specifics after a call to better understand your expectations.

How long does it take to see results from SEO?

It typically takes at least 2 to 3 months to start seeing initial results. However, for more significant, noticeable improvements, you can expect 4 to 6 months of consistent SEO work to see considerable results.

Do I need to have a website to use your SEO services?

Yes, a website is required to use our SEO services. If you don’t have a website yet, we can help you create one that’s optimized for search engines to support your SEO efforts from the start.

Can you help with Google My Business optimization?

Yes, we can optimize your Google My Business profile. This includes setting up or refining your profile to improve local search visibility, manage reviews, and enhance your online presence, ultimately helping you attract more local leads.

What is included in your monthly SEO reports?

Our monthly SEO reports include key metrics such as keyword rankings and website traffic. We also provide a summary of the work we’ve done over the past month, detailing the strategies we implemented and the improvements made. Additionally, we outline our plan for the upcoming month to keep you informed about the next steps in your SEO campaign.